That looks like crab grass. If you pull out a clump does it look like
this?

http://www.meredithsuewillis.com/images/crabgrass.jpg

If so, the best way to control it is just pull out the clumps when the
ground is moist. They come out quite easily. Crab grass is an annual
so next spring use a pre-emergent grab grass preventer/fertilizer. Be
sure to use it early because if the temperature hits a certain point
the seeds germinate and it is too late.

There are sprays for it but they've never worked well for me.

I'm assuming the broadleaf grass is the problem grass, yes?
Looks a lot like good old St. Augustine. Do you live in the southern
tier of states.

If it is SA, it's a ground cover that a lot of people use in the south
because it is hardy and dominant. I also called it ugly and a water
sucker, among other things. SA spreads by runners close to the
ground. If you pull it, you have to pull it all, even the ends of the
runners.

You didnt say what part of the country you're from, but that looks
like plain ol'Tall Fescue. Its a clumping grass and in a blue grass
lawn it looks terrible. Not much you can do except dig it out by hand
(lots of work), or spray it with a general herbicide such as Round Up
and reseed the spots next year. Round Up will kill the rest of the
lawn too so be careful.
